About the Organisation


This well-established professional body represents over 10,000 members working across government, business, academia and the third sector. The organisation develops careers and competencies, delivers high-quality professional development and training, convenes influential events, publishes thought leadership, and plays an active role in shaping environmental policy.

Having declared a climate and biodiversity emergency, the organisation is committed to empowering its members to drive sustainable change nationally and globally.


The Role


The Chief Executive Officer will lead and shape the strategic direction of the organisation, ensuring it operates effectively, sustainably and in alignment with its mission and values.


Working closely with the Chair and Board of Trustees, the CEO will be accountable for overall financial and operational performance, delivery of the growth strategy, and enhancing the organisation’s reputation and impact at national and international levels.


This role requires a visible, credible and influential leader who can build strong partnerships across government, industry, academia and the wider environmental community.


The CEO will:


  • Develop and deliver the organisation’s strategic and operational plans
  • Ensure long-term financial sustainability and identify new income opportunities
  • Strengthen the membership value proposition and support growth and retention
  • Provide effective governance support to the Board of Trustees
  • Build and maintain high-level external relationships and partnerships
  • Act as principal ambassador, raising the organisation’s profile and influence
  • Lead, motivate and develop a high-performing executive team
  • Champion diversity, equity and inclusion
  • Drive digital innovation and organisational effectiveness
  • Oversee policy leadership aligned with member interests
